- ABSTRACT: Melaleuca quinquenervia (hereafter melaleuca) was until recently one of the worst ecological invaders in Florida. Introduced for horticulture and levee stabilisation during the early twentieth century, melaleuca spread to cover vast areas of the largest freshwater wetlands ecosystem in North America, The Everglades. From 1997 until 2008, four insects and an associated nematode were approved and released for control of melaleuca, three of which are known to have established. Biological control is frequently a slow and incremental process, but with the integration of complimentary control methods (e.g. chemical and mechanical removal), melaleuca infestations are a fraction of their former range. These few persistent infestations are facilitated by conditions that prevent one species, Oxyops vitiosa, the melaleuca snout weevil, from completing its life cycle, which prompted the testing of and application to release Lophodiplosis indentata (Diptera: Cecidomyiidae). This leaf gall forming midge feeds within pea-shaped growths distributed throughout the canopy. No-choice host range tests suggest that L. indentata will occasionally oviposit on unsuitable host plants, but gall induction and formation is only accomplished on M. quinquenervia. A petition for the release of L. indentata was recommended by TAG in May 2020. [word count: 181]
